NATSO and WPMA Tap the Power of Partnership for 2012 Education and Trade Events, Co-mingled Shows Offer Attendees and Exhibitors Unparalleled Business and Networking Opportunities

/

Seizing an unprecedented opportunity to tap into the power of partnership, NATSO, the national association representing truckstops and travel plazas, and the Western Petroleum Marketers Association (WPMA) announced they will share educational resources as well as business and networking opportunities for exhibitors and attendees at the NATSO Show and WPMAs National Convention & Convenience Store Expo scheduled to be held in February in Las Vegas, Nevada. 

The NATSO Show will be held at Caesars Palace Feb. 18-22, 2012, offering two-and-a-half days of innovative experts focused on ahead-of-the-curve trends, a knowledge-filled human library built for a customized learning experience, and exhibitors that showcase tomorrows hottest products and servicesall designed to meet the unique needs of travel plaza and truckstop leaders. 

WPMAs National Convention & Convenience Store Expo will be held at the Mirage Convention Center Feb. 21-23, 2012. The Expo offers two-and-a-half days of world re-renowned speakers and seminars, networking, and access to more than 90,000 square feet of tradeshow space with exhibitors displaying and selling the latest in technology, c-store innovations, and truck and trailer displays to meet the needs of the petroleum industry.

By co-mingling two of the industrys premier trade shows, this partnership connects those selling petroleum products to consumers with petroleum distributors, wholesalers and jobbers as well as vendors across the industry. NATSO Members and WPMA Marketer Members who register for one trade show automatically will be registered to attend the neighboring show at no additional cost. Each show will feature its own exhibit hall, as well as unique educational programming for attendees.

“Our mission is to create value for our members, so of course we are excited to be able to open up this brand new opportunity in Las Vegas for our attendees to learn and network,” said NATSO president and CEO Lisa Mullings. “We are extremely fortunate to be able to partner with such a respected organization.”

WPMA Executive Director Gene Inglesby welcomed the partnership opportunity. With NATSO, well now have an even stronger platform for increasing the attendee value proposition for both events, Inglesby said. Attendees will benefit from a wide array of educational programming. Exhibitors at both shows will take advantage of the expanded marketing opportunity and additional traffic on the show floor.

The NATSO Show is designed to be an indispensible resource for truckstop and travel plaza leaders. In Las Vegas, The NATSO Show will focus sharply on the unique needs of key contributors to the truckstop and travel plaza industry, connecting them with peers, business intelligence and game-changing products and technology. Founded in 1960, NATSO represents the industry on legislative and regulatory matters; serves as the official source of information on the diverse travel plaza and truckstop industry; provides education to its members; conducts an annual convention and trade show; and supports efforts to generally improve the business climate in which its members operate.

WPMA Tradeshow Convention established 1953, provides resources for education, training and exchange of ideas to Petroleum Marketers, Distributor, Jobbers, and Convenience store owner operators and anyone in the primary business of selling petroleum products. WPMA assists members in increasing their business effectiveness and profitability by; encouraging a high level of business ethics and a positive image for the industry and encouraging governmental action beneficial to the industry through the active participation of its membership. Tiffany Wlazlowski Neuman
Wlazlowski Neuman leads NATSO and the NATSO Foundation’s public affairs initiatives and communications strategies to promote the truck stop and travel center industry to the public, opinion leaders, elected officials, and the media. Her outreach includes a spectrum of policy issues facing the industry, with a particular focus on transportation and fuel issues, truck parking, and human trafficking. She serves as NATSO’s representative on the U.S. Department of Transportation’s National Truck Parking Coalition, the Clean Freight Coalition, and various state truck parking technical advisory committees. She is the architect of the truck stop and travel center industry’s anti-human trafficking campaign and currently serves as a Committee member for the U.S. Department of Transportation’s Human Trafficking Advisory Council. Wlazlowski Neuman serves on the American Highway Users Policy and Government Affairs Committee.
